# Heads up, support folks: the resolver inside Glimmerhost occasionally
# flakes out when the upstream Nimbleway DNS pool rotates nodes. You'll
# see it as intermittent "host not found" errors that clear on retry —
# annoying, but harmless if the retry budget below isn't exhausted. We
# added jittered backoff so bursts don't hammer the pool. If customers
# report timeouts, check these knobs first before escalating to the
# platform crew. Current tuning constants are as follows.

constants for bagaf-hadup:
QUOTAS = {
    "quenael": 1,
    "ralwyn": 1,
    "oliath": 2,
    "ulaael": 2,
}

Ticket: Vault sealed — Pexel metrics sidecar

The credentials vault used by the Pexel aggregation sidecar sealed itself after last night's host reboot, so the sidecar cannot fetch its write token and metrics are queuing locally. Support may see dashboards lagging by up to an hour; data is not lost. To restore service, unseal the vault on the affected node and restart the sidecar. The recovery passphrase required for the unseal step is below.

recovery phrase for fajep-yaweg: gilath-sorox-wenius-rusdor-keliel-zorius

## Queue-Depth Autoscaler

Scaler `qflex` polls the Marrowline broker every 15s. Scale-out trigger: depth > 5k for 2 intervals. Scale-in: depth < 500 for 10 intervals. Floor 3, ceiling 40 workers. Flapping? Freeze with `qflex hold --ttl=30m`, then inspect consumer lag before unfreezing. Never edit the ceiling during an incident. All qflex commands authenticate against the internal Scalehub control plane using the key below.

API key for tagef-fafop: vxb2-ta

Known issue: the Lanternfish client drops its websocket after idle timeouts and the reconnect logic re-subscribes twice, causing duplicate order events downstream. A fix is staged behind the reconnect_v2 flag; it must not ship in the same release as the gateway upgrade, as the two were only tested separately. Please sequence accordingly in the release calendar. For questions about the flag rollout, reach the owning engineer here.

escalation mailbox, yafog-kafof: eliok@xolmarcloud.local